What is Address Change Form

The Address Change Request Form is a document used by account holders to update their mailing address for account-related communications with the Marion County Assessor's office.

Field-by-Field Instructions for Completing the Form

When filling out the Address Change Request Form, specific information is required for each field. Key fields include:
  • Account Number(s).
  • Name on Account(s).
  • New Mailing Address.
  • City, State, and Zip Code.
  • Signature and Date.
  • Phone Number for contact.
Ensuring accuracy in these fields helps to avoid common mistakes and guarantees that your request is processed without delays.

The Address Change Request Form is intended for account holders registered with the Marion County Assessor's office who need to update their mailing address.
You can submit the completed Address Change Request Form via mail, fax, or deliver it in person to the Marion County Assessor's office, depending on what is most convenient.
Typically, no additional supporting documents are required; however, ensure you provide accurate account details to avoid processing delays.
Make sure to double-check your account number and mailing address for accuracy, and ensure that all required fields are filled out before submission.
Processing times may vary; however, allow for several business days after submission for your address change to be updated in the system.
No, notarization is not required for the Address Change Request Form; however, it must be signed by the account holder.
To check the status of your request, contact the Marion County Assessor's office directly, usually via phone or their official website.
